Feats Only Immortals Can Accomplish

Ten minutes later.

The materials Jiang Yuan needed for refining were brought to the scene by two guards.

After verifying the materials, the Medicine Master turned to Jiang Yuan and said, “Young man, most of the materials you need are ready, except for the energy crystal.”

“If we don’t have it, it’s fine. I’ll find it myself.”

Jiang Yuan didn’t seem disappointed. The formation conditions for energy crystals are extremely stringent, and their rarity is comparable to hundred-year spiritual herbs. It’s normal for the Tang Chamber of Commerce to lack them.

After thinking for a moment, the Medicine Master added, “Energy crystals belong to rune materials. We may not have them here, but the Inscription Master Guild also known as Rune Master Guild might.”

“However, even if the guild has such rare rune materials, they wouldn’t be sold to the public.”

“To obtain these rune materials, you would need to join the Rune Master Guild. Only by becoming an exclusive rune master for the guild who contributes enough to the guild, can you exchange materials using contribution points.”

“Got it.” Jiang Yuan nodded disinterestedly then walked to the refining materials, preparing to start the process.

The Medicine Master stopped talking and focused on watching Jiang Yuan, paying attention to every move, and afraid of missing any details in each step.

Others also stared with widened eyes, fixedly observing Jiang Yuan. They wanted to see what technique this man used to refine a tenth-grade pill.

“I’ll teach only once, pay attention.” Jiang Yuan ignited five furnaces simultaneously and tossed the materials into each.

“What… what!”

“Is he planning to… simultaneously refine five times?”

“Are you kidding? How can he concentrate with such a method?”

Everyone was shocked by Jiang Yuan’s actions.

It’s well known that alchemists need intense concentration and complete focus when refining pills, without any distractions. Even the most outstanding alchemy grandmasters can only refine one at a time.

Yet, this man intends to simultaneously refine five times?

This completely subverts everyone’s understanding!

However, this isn’t the end.

Jiang Yuan’s subsequent actions further overturn everyone’s understanding!

After tossing the materials into the furnaces, Jiang Yuan turned to organizing runic materials.

What’s going on?

Does he plan to refine pills and engrave runes simultaneously?

Before people could understand, Jiang Yuan had already prepared four complete runic materials.

With his left hand, Jiang Yuan infused energy into the five furnaces while his right hand picked up a mysterious golden pen, sequentially inscribing runes on the four materials.

“No… no way? In the case of simultaneously refining five times, he also wants to simultaneously inscribe four runes?”

“Can he really handle all of this by himself?”

“I can’t even imagine how he’ll accomplish such a thing.”

People shook their heads in disbelief because what Jiang Yuan was doing at this moment had completely exceeded their imagination.

Compared to the astonishment of others, Jiang Yuan appeared very relaxed and even nonchalant.

While controlling the heat of the furnaces, he casually inscribed runes, and calmly stated, “Not only the refining technique, but your understanding of refining time and control over heat also have significant issues.”

Everyone couldn’t help but inhale a breath of cold air, looking at Jiang Yuan with eyes that resembled those observing a monster.

While refining five times and four times engraving runes, and he could still casually lecture? What kind of creature was he?

“Can you tell me about the correct refining time and how to control the heat?” the Medicine Master asked Jiang Yuan eagerly.

Jiang Yuan yawned and said listlessly, “The refining time is not about being longer, it depends on the degree of heat control. The better the heat control, the shorter the refining time.”

“To control the heat well, you must have sufficient mental power. Your current mental power is too weak to control the heat properly.”

Upon hearing Jiang Yuan’s words, everyone nearly spurted blood.

It’s well known that both alchemy and runecrafting demand a high level of mental power. Those who become alchemists and rune masters generally have mental power far beyond ordinary people.

Hailed as the grandmaster of alchemy, the Medicine Master had formidable mental power even standing at the forefront of the entire Zhongzhou.

Such a prominent figure was now being criticized for having weak mental power. The irony was hard to ignore!

“You’re right, my current mental power is indeed too weak.” The Medicine Master admitted humbly.

His humble attitude made him seem more like an apprentice who had just started rather than the grandmaster of alchemy.

For the next few minutes, the Medicine Master continuously sought advice from Jiang Yuan.

His questions were profound, delving into not only how to enhance mental power but also touching on the origins of alchemy—a profound subject he had been unable to comprehend throughout his life.

However, Jiang Yuan effortlessly answered these so-called profound questions in just a few words.

Hearing Jiang Yuan’s answers, the Medicine Master was repeatedly astonished.

Jiang Yuan’s insights into alchemy completely overturned his understanding, broadening his horizons and benefiting him greatly. In contrast to the Medicine Master’s amazement, the onlookers in the hall were utterly confused.

To them, the conversation between Jiang Yuan and the Medicine Master sounded like gibberish.

They listened as Jiang Yuan lectured the Medicine Master who marveled at every word, and they remained bewildered throughout.

Until the end, they were completely numb.

As the conversation continued, the Medicine Master’s tone towards Jiang Yuan became increasingly respectful. In the end, he resembled an eager apprentice, earnestly requesting Jiang Yuan to explain more knowledge.

His disciples were in complete disarray. They could hardly believe it.

Wasn’t this the knowledgeable master they remembered?

It was as if he had completely changed!

Even after Jiang Yuan finished engraving, the Medicine Master was still unsatisfied, having many more questions he wanted to ask Jiang Yuan.

At this moment, the five furnaces began emitting white smoke, indicating that the refining process had ended.

“I’ve taught you what I needed to. Whether you can learn it or not depends on your comprehension.” Jiang Yuan yawned, then uncovered the lids of the five furnaces.

People crowded around, eager to see what had happened. Upon seeing the scene inside the furnaces, everyone was too shocked to speak. Five crystal-clear pills were placed in each of the five furnaces. Under the sunlight, each pill emitted a dazzling light.

“They are all tenth-grade pills!”

“My god! Refining five tenth-grade pills at the same time! And simultaneously engraving four times!”

“Unbelievable! What kind of monster is this?!”

Although Jiang Yuan had previously refined a tenth-grade pill, seeing this scene still shocked everyone present.

Because refining a single tenth-grade pill with full concentration is entirely different from refining multiple tenth-grade pills while also engraving runes at the same time.

When wholly focused on one refinement, these accomplished alchemists could produce fifth-grade pills. But if asked to simultaneously refine five times, they wouldn’t even be able to produce first-grade wasted pills.

However, this man could simultaneously refine five times and engrave four times, resulting in five tenth-grade pills!

Could a human really achieve such a feat?

This was simply feats only immortals could accomplish!
